The Real Techniques Sam’s Picks Makeup brush set was launched as a limited edition set, that is thankfully still available on a lot of sites both in India and internationally.
I have been using the Real Techniques Expert face brush for a while and realize how wonderful the product is. I think it’s great to get a good quality brush for a reasonable price as the high end one’s can cost a bundle.
Packaging: The box of six is nice large and holds all the brushes well in the cardboard set. The back has a list of the brushes with their intended purpose, a real boon for those of us who are just beginning to use brushes instead of our fingertips. The full box was bulky for me to hang on to, so I simply cut out the list of brushes and kept it on my dresser, for easy reference.
Sam’s Picks : This Makeup Brush Set has 6 brushes – Real Techniques color codes the brushes, pink for finishing, gold yellow for base and purple for eyes. They also write the name of the brush on the handle, something that’s really cool.
Multi-task Brush – for effortless application of powder lush and bronzer.
This is a setting brush that I have used for both bronzer and blush. The bristles are really soft and fluffy but have a bit of hold so that the brush does not bend completely during application. The density of the bristles is high but not as high as the buffing or the expert brush.
Blush and bronzer go on beautifully as this picks up just enough product to create a subtle daily work wear look.
Buffing Brush – ideal for full coverage application of powder and mineral foundation.
This brush has pretty much changed my life! No, I’m no exaggerating here. I had a ton of powder foundations, such as MAC Studiofix which were languishing in my dresser since I was just not able to get a nice enough look with the sponge. Enter, Real Techniques buffing brush. I now use this almost daily for the application of powder foundation. This is high in density and picks up more powder than the earlier one. Buffing is very easy and the foundation seems to work best with this brush.
Essential Crease Brush – soft tapered design for effortless contouring.
Super soft crease brush that works well for shadow application. I don’t really spend much time contouring, so I’m not going to get too much use out of this one. For those of you who are interested, it works quite well, soft silky bristles that bend just enough for correct application. This one is a set exclusive and won’t be available stand alone.
Fine Liner Brush – ultimate tool for precision application of liquid or cream eyeliner.
The description on this is absolutely perfect – the brush works perfectly for gel eyeliner. I have realized how much of a difference it makes to use this instead of the brush that comes in the kit with the gel eyeliner. I have actually started using my gel liners much more due to this.
Setting Brush – complete any look with a controlled dusting of powder or highlighter.
This is again very soft and small enough to give you a very controlled application of powder for finishing. I am very partial to my Laura Mercier Fan brush for applying highlighter so I haven’t tried this yet for highlighter. It works very well for dusting of powder though. I don’t really need so much control for a basic day look, so the larger finishing brushes work fine for me however.
This is great for someone who wants to create a very precise look.
Pointed foundation brush – use with liquid foundation to build custom coverage.
Another great brush for applying precise liquid foundation. I use this to pat foundation in my eye area. It is flat and stiff and allows you to reach into the corners very well. In fact I tried this with my concealer as well and it worked beautifully.

Overall Thoughts
Real Techniques Sam’s Picks Makeup Brush Set is really Value for Money with each brush costing less than Rs 400. I absolutely adore four out of the six in this set, which makes it perfect for me. All the brushes are soft to touch and feel really like the other high end MAC or Laura Mercier brushes that I have. In my opinion, Real Techniques is a great brand and one that should not be ignored even if you have a higher budget.
I have washed all these a few times and none of the brushes have shed at all – colour and shape is fully retained. I’m sure these are going to serve me well.
